:root{--driver-z-index:100000;--driver-overlay-color:#000;--driver-overlay-opacity:.8;--tour-accent:#1db38a}.driver-overlay{z-index:100000!important}.driver-popover{border-radius:.5rem;max-width:400px;z-index:100001!important;background-color:#18181b!important;border:1px solid rgba(29,179,138,.22)!important;box-shadow:0 20px 25px -5px rgba(0,0,0,.3),0 8px 10px -6px rgba(0,0,0,.3)!important}.driver-popover-title{margin:0;padding:1rem 1rem .5rem;font-size:1.125rem;font-weight:600;color:#fafafa!important}.driver-popover-description{margin:0;padding:0 1rem 1rem;font-size:.875rem;line-height:1.5;color:#a1a1aa!important}.driver-popover-footer{border-top:1px solid #3f3f46;justify-content:space-between;align-items:center;padding:.75rem 1rem;display:flex}.driver-popover-progress-text{font-size:.8125rem;font-weight:500;color:#a1a1aa!important}.driver-popover-navigation-btns{gap:.5rem;display:flex}.driver-popover-btn{cursor:pointer;border:none;border-radius:.375rem;outline:none;padding:.5rem 1rem;font-size:.875rem;font-weight:500;transition:all .15s;text-shadow:none!important}.driver-popover-footer button,.driver-popover-prev-btn,.driver-popover-next-btn{-webkit-font-smoothing:antialiased;text-shadow:none!important}.driver-popover-btn:focus{outline:2px solid var(--tour-accent);outline-offset:2px}.driver-popover-close-btn{border-radius:.375rem;justify-content:center;align-items:center;width:2rem;height:2rem;padding:.25rem;display:flex;position:absolute;top:.5rem;right:.5rem;color:#a1a1aa!important;background-color:transparent!important}.driver-popover-close-btn:hover,.driver-popover-prev-btn{color:#fafafa!important;background-color:#27272a!important}.driver-popover-prev-btn:hover{background-color:#3f3f46!important}.driver-popover-next-btn{color:#0d0d0d!important;background-color:#fefefe!important}.driver-popover-next-btn:hover{background-color:#f4f4f5!important}.driver-popover-arrow{display:none}.driver-active-element{border-radius:.375rem;z-index:100000!important}.driver-popover.driver-popover-auto-align[data-side=top],.driver-popover.driver-popover-auto-align[data-side=bottom]{max-width:min(400px,90vw)}@media (max-width:640px){.driver-popover{max-width:calc(100vw - 2rem)}}
